Research based illustrations of the use cases of the bluzelle database

in #blockchain4 years ago

Bluzelle is the distributed open-source database service founded in 2014 by Pavel Bains and Neeraj Murarka to enable the storage and management of data in a secure, durable and highly efficient manner.

The database, which is powered by Cosmos and its BFT technology, Tindermint, is a decentralized data-store technology providing highly scalable, cost-effective and secure storage solutions for decentralized applications (dApps).

bluzelle8.png


By utilizing swarming technologies, the decentralized data layer is solving the numerous data breach and data theft challenges faced by dApps developers as they continue to build dApps. The database uses algorithms that store data in a coordinated way to ensure that dApps developers achieve the highest throughput in performance, data security and scalability.

The use cases of the Bluzelle database are wide-ranging. However, in this article, we will look at the most important use cases of the database.


Use cases of the bluzelle database

Data Storage

Bluzelle provides a decentralized data storage facility for dApps. The database enables dApps to store and manage their data in a place that is both decentralized and mutable.

Bluzelle algorithms store data in a unique, distributed and intelligent manner to provide enterprise-level scalability. The database leverages blockchain technology to make it impossible to change a data once the data is stored to the network.

Bluzelle redundantly store tiny pieces of data on nodes across the globe to eliminate any point of failure. This helps to keep developers' data easily accessible, censorship resistant and secure from hackers.


Data caching

Apart from its use as a data storage facility, the Bluzelle data-store technology can be used as a data cache. Caches reduce the loads on databases by enabling dApps to easily request for frequently used data.

Bluzelle cache helps dApps to store data that is regularly used. This saves time and data by enabling developers to access frequently used data faster without having to hit the database each time for data.

The Bluzelle cache provides developers with numerous decentralized nodes operated by members of the public all over the world. This helps to ensure that users have access to the cache no matter their location.


Bluzelle - Screen - Logo - Big - Blue.png


Online gaming

The Bluzelle database is also revolutionizing the online gaming sector. With the database's decentralized data cache, there are data centers dispersed throughout the world where the data of online games are replicated at the same time.

By using the Cache, game developers do not have to worry about setting up each time in different locations where the data is already dispersed. This means that no matter the location of game players, they will get the best game performance possible.


Media

By utilizing its cache, Bluzelle is also impacting the media sector. The Bluzelle cache provides caching services to media houses and handles the vast metadata that is being collected, generated and disseminated by the media. This metadata is critical to being competitive and the ability to deliver data results quickly for use. Through its cache, Bluzelle is enabling streaming media companies to reach a global customer base and acquire a performance advantage.


Crypto currency exchanges

The Bluzelle database enables crypto currency exchanges through its tokens: the Ethereum ERC-20 external token (BLZ) and the Bluzelle Network Token (BNT). The externally tradable token (BLZ) bridges the BNT with Ethereum's own native ETH token. To participate in the network as a consumer, users can buy BLZ tokens on a crypto-exchange using ETH, BTC or other crypto currencies the exchange allows. The BLZ tokens will then be utilized to issue BNT tokens to the user on the Bluzelle Token Gateway. Using the issued BNT tokens, the user can then transact in the network.


Conclusion

The use cases of the Bluzelle Database are vast. The use cases discussed in this article are just a tip of the benefits Bluzelle is equipped to deliver.

Implementing effective storage and management of data is a challenge for dApps developers and the Bluzelle decentralized database offers the right solution to the challenge.

REFERENCES

  • About Bluzelle; the Decentralized Database. Accessed at: www.bluzelle.com

  • DApps Use Cases of the Bluzelle Database. Accessed at: https://bluzelle.com/blog/bluzelle-cache-use-cases

  • Pavel Bains and Neeraj Murarka (2017) Bluzelle: A Decentralized Database for the Future. Whitepaper V1.4.